What the numbers say
The median Software Developer in Hawaii earned $119,880 in 2024, about 13% below the national median of $138,520. The mean came in at $124,960, which sits close enough to the median that a small group of high earners is not pulling the average far from the middle. The distribution here is relatively even by that measure.
The spread from the 10th to the 90th percentile runs from $53,840 to $194,220. Top earners make roughly 3.6 times what the lowest-paid developers in the state take home. That gap is wide, and it likely reflects differences in how senior someone is, what kind of software they build, and whether they work for a local business or a company based elsewhere.
Hawaii's cost of living sits about 13% above the national baseline. Once you account for that, the nominal discount to the US median deepens. A developer earning the state median here has roughly the same purchasing power as someone earning around $105,900 in an average-cost state. That puts real wages further from national parity than the headline number suggests.
BLS projects growth for Software Developers nationally at 15.8% between 2024 and 2034, which falls in the much faster than average category. Hawaii's employment base for this occupation is small at 1,940 workers, so even modest absolute growth could shift the local market noticeably.

Software Developers in Hawaii: actual employer-disclosed pay
Public records from 23 certified H-1B Labor Condition Applications filed with the U.S. Department of Labor. Median offered wage: $100,797. Every figure below is an actual offered salary an employer attested to under federal law.
By DOL wage level
DOL classifies every offer into one of four wage levels based on the role's experience and skill requirements.
| Level | Filings | Median offer |
|---|---|---|
| Level I — entry | 5 | $63,000 |
| Level II — qualified | 7 | $100,000 |
| Level III — experienced | 3 | $164,263 |
| Level IV — fully competent | 1 | $200,624 |
